Environment Awareness Week at Greenfield Senior Secondary School
Reported by: Rahul Batheja, Class XII, Member – Editorial Board
Greenfield Senior Secondary School observed Environment Awareness Week from 3rd to 8th August 2025 with the aim of sensitising students towards environmental issues and encouraging eco-friendly practices. The week-long programme was inaugurated by the Principal, Mrs. Kavita Sharma, who stressed the urgent need for sustainable living and student-led initiatives in conserving natural resources.
The activities began with an Inter-House Poster-Making Competition on the theme “Our Earth, Our Responsibility”, where colourful and thought-provoking artworks adorned the school auditorium. This was followed by a Tree Plantation Drive in which over 150 saplings were planted in the school premises and nearby community park. Students from Classes IX to XII actively participated, with the Eco Club members guiding younger students on proper planting techniques.
A Special Assembly was conducted mid-week, featuring speeches, street plays, and poetry recitations on topics such as climate change, plastic pollution, and renewable energy. The highlight of the week was an Awareness Rally organised in the neighbourhood, where students carried placards and raised slogans promoting waste segregation and water conservation. Additionally, a Workshop on Waste Management was held in collaboration with the Municipal Corporation, introducing students to composting and recycling methods.
The participation from students was enthusiastic and wholehearted—over 500 students took part in at least one activity. Teachers also contributed by supervising events and integrating environmental topics into their lessons throughout the week.
The overall impact was profound: the school campus now boasts a greener look, waste segregation bins have been installed in every classroom, and students have pledged to reduce single-use plastic. The initiative not only raised awareness but also instilled a sense of responsibility and community spirit among the school population.
The week concluded with a Pledge Ceremony where students vowed to adopt eco-friendly habits in their daily lives, ensuring that the spirit of Environment Awareness Week continues throughout the year.
